The EUTRKei Grill Table is a sturdy and spacious grill cart designed mainly for Blackstone griddles or similar tabletop grills, making it an excellent choice for outdoor cooking enthusiasts seeking a reliable setup. Its large surface area of about 527 square inches provides ample room for your griddle and prep space, along with a handy condiment caddy and a lower shelf for plates or utensils.

Constructed from solid metal, the cart supports up to 300 pounds and remains stable during cooking sessions without wobbling. Portability is a notable feature — the cart folds down easily with safety locks to maintain stability when folded and includes wheels for smooth movement, which makes it convenient for tailgating, camping, or backyard use. Storage options are well thought out, offering multiple hooks, a bottle opener, a paper towel holder, and organized spots for tools and gas hoses to keep everything within easy reach.

Weighing nearly 30 pounds, the cart is portable but may be a bit heavy for those needing something ultra-lightweight. It is primarily designed for grills sized 17” or 22”, so larger or smaller grills might not fit as well. Temperature control depends on your grill since this unit functions as a stand; however, its anti-slip mat ensures your griddle remains stable during cooking. For those looking for a durable, well-designed grill cart that balances size, portability, and practical extras, the EUTRKei model is a fitting option, especially for Blackstone griddle owners.

The Leteuke Grill Cart is a versatile outdoor cooking companion designed to support various grill types, making it a great choice for barbecue enthusiasts. With a size of 43'D x 17'W x 30'H, it comfortably accommodates grills up to 31' x 17', while the sturdy carbon steel construction ensures it can handle heavy use, supporting up to 450 pounds. Its foldable design and four wheels make it easy to transport and store, which is ideal for those with limited space or who enjoy cooking in different outdoor settings.

One of the standout features of this grill cart is its ample storage capacity. It comes with a bottom board that can hold a 20-pound gas cylinder, along with hooks, a knife holder, and a tissue box, providing plenty of space for grilling tools and accessories. This organization can streamline your outdoor cooking experience, making it more enjoyable.

There are some drawbacks to consider. While the assembly is straightforward, it's important to note that some users have reported minor issues with the stability of the cart when fully loaded. Additionally, while the carbon steel material is durable, it may require regular maintenance to prevent rusting, especially if exposed to the elements frequently. The cart's ergonomic handles and flexible wheels enhance its usability, allowing for smooth maneuvering.

Buying Guide for the Best Grill Cart

Choosing the right grill cart can significantly enhance your outdoor cooking experience. A grill cart is a versatile piece of equipment that combines the functionality of a grill with the convenience of a mobile cart. When selecting a grill cart, it's important to consider various specifications to ensure it meets your cooking needs and fits your outdoor space. Here are some key specifications to consider and how to navigate them.
Size and Cooking AreaThe size and cooking area of a grill cart determine how much food you can cook at once. This is important because it affects how efficiently you can prepare meals, especially when cooking for a group. Grill carts come in various sizes, from compact models suitable for small patios to larger ones designed for big gatherings. If you often cook for a large family or host parties, opt for a grill cart with a larger cooking area. For occasional use or smaller households, a compact grill cart will suffice.
Fuel TypeGrill carts can be powered by different types of fuel, including propane, natural gas, charcoal, and electric. The fuel type affects the flavor of the food, ease of use, and maintenance. Propane and natural gas grills offer convenience and quick heating, making them ideal for frequent use. Charcoal grills provide a traditional smoky flavor but require more time and effort to manage. Electric grills are easy to use and clean but may lack the authentic grilling taste. Choose a fuel type based on your cooking preferences and lifestyle.
Material and Build QualityThe material and build quality of a grill cart impact its durability and performance. Common materials include stainless steel, cast iron, and aluminum. Stainless steel is highly durable, resistant to rust, and easy to clean, making it a popular choice. Cast iron retains heat well but requires more maintenance to prevent rust. Aluminum is lightweight and resistant to corrosion but may not be as durable as stainless steel. Consider the climate in your area and how often you plan to use the grill when choosing the material.
Portability and StoragePortability and storage features are crucial for a grill cart, especially if you have limited outdoor space or plan to move the grill frequently. Look for carts with sturdy wheels and handles for easy maneuverability. Some models also come with foldable shelves or storage compartments for utensils and accessories. If you need to store the grill during the off-season, consider a model that can be easily disassembled or has a compact design.
Temperature ControlTemperature control is essential for achieving the desired cooking results. Grill carts may have various temperature control features, such as adjustable burners, dampers, or digital controls. Adjustable burners allow you to control the heat intensity, which is useful for cooking different types of food. Dampers help regulate airflow in charcoal grills, affecting the cooking temperature. Digital controls offer precise temperature settings and are user-friendly. Choose a grill cart with temperature control features that match your cooking style and expertise.
Additional FeaturesAdditional features can enhance your grilling experience and provide added convenience. These may include side burners, rotisserie kits, warming racks, and built-in thermometers. Side burners are useful for cooking side dishes or sauces while grilling. Rotisserie kits allow you to cook whole chickens or roasts evenly. Warming racks keep cooked food warm without overcooking it. Built-in thermometers help monitor the cooking temperature accurately. Consider which additional features will be most beneficial for your cooking needs.
